« テーブル定義書の自動生成 | メイン | テーブル定義書の自動生成 その3 »

ethna

テーブル定義書の自動生成 その2

列名を日本語表記する。 WEBをデータベースのフロントエンドとすると、機械的に全部の列をフォーム定義することがほとんど。 列とフォーム要素は1対1として action の継承元で
という具合。さらに、view の継承元で
とすれば、template で↓

{$formDef[fieldName].name}

のようにフォーム定義を参照可能になる。もちろん

{$formDef[fieldName].option}

でデータベースへセットするHTML SELECT要素・RADIO要素などの各配列要素も表示できる。

トラックバック

このエントリーのトラックバックURL:
http://www.remix.asia/cgi/mt/mt-tb.cgi/6550

コメントを投稿

(いままで、ここでコメントしたことがないときは、コメントを表示する前にこのブログのオーナーの承認が必要になることがあります。承認されるまではコメントは表示されません。そのときはしばらく待ってください。)